Criminal Statute of Limitations in South Dakota In South Dakota, all misdemeanors carry a lengthy seven-year statute of limitations. Most felonies also have a seven-year statute of limitations. Class A, B, and C felonies do not have any statute of limitations.
In general, the borrower gets one year to redeem the home after a foreclosure sale. (S.D. Codified Laws § 21-52-11). But if the mortgage is a short-term redemption mortgage, the redemption period is 180 days after the purchaser from the foreclosure sale records a certificate of sale in the land records.
51A-17-4. License to engage in business of money transmission required. No person, other than a person who is exempt under § 51A-17-3, may engage in the business of money transmission in this state without obtaining a license in ance with this chapter and undergoing a criminal background investigation.

Statute of limitations in contracts for sale. (1)An action for breach of any contract for sale must be commenced within four years after the cause of action has accrued. (2)A cause of action accrues when the breach occurs, regardless of the aggrieved party's lack of knowledge of the breach.
